Vivien of Holloway

This blog post is about my review on the vintage reproduction fashion brand Vivien of Holloway!












Vivien of Holloway are based in London, UK and all their clothing items are made in London. This brand sells both men and ladies vintage inspired fashion clothing and accessories. For example men: shirts and t-shirts and for women: dresses, skirts, trousers, tops and blouses. They also sell women's accessories for example jewelery, hair accessories, lingerie, petticoats and bags.

Vivien of Holloway have their own website where you can find all their fashion items they have for sale to buy for yourself, the website is: http://www.vivienofholloway.com/
There's also a sister Australian based store called "Christine's" that sell's Vivien of Holloway's clothing and accessories, which is located in Melbourne, Victoria.

I currently own two dresses, and a pair of red swing trousers from this brand. The first dress I bought for myself was around six months ago, this particular dress was on "sale" for a very good price on their online website. I loved the style and floral print on it. So I had to buy it! This dress is called "halterneck floral fiesta circle dress".
Floral Fiesta Dress



This dress is so gorgeous, I love the halterneck and swing style of this dress and also the floral fabric print with all those colors. Another bonus this dress came with it's own matching bolero, as shown in picture of the model on the left.

This dress is very well made and also had a boned bodice, which is something I don't have in any of my other swing/circle dresses.

It's made of cotton material and has a back zipper, to get in and out of.





Here's myself styling this gorgeous dress.
I really love Vivien of Holloway inspired vintage ladies clothing, because they are really well-made and constructed and their clothing pieces and accessories actually feel like your wearing a true vintage piece from the 1940's/50's.
Vivien of Holloway's pricing is of medium to the high price range, usually ranging between ($80 - $200) for a particular item of clothing. But from time to time, you can pick up something for a very good price in the "sale" section on their website.

The sizes are quite different to everyday mainstream clothing, so just follow the size guide and measurements to make sure you order the right size, if buying online.

The next dress I bought for myself was around three months ago, again from the actual website and in the "sale" section, this dress is the "kitty day dress" in a pink gingham/floral print.
Kitty day dress


I really love the style, color and fabric print of this dress. I also love how this dress has pockets and I also like the buttons down the front of this dress.

I find you have to wear a belt though, whilst wearing this dress, because myself personally think it looks and sits better whist wearing this lovely frock.

This dress also came with it's own matching hair scarf. It's  made of a cotton material and has a zipper down the side and buttons down the front to get and out of.







Here I am styling this lovely dress.
You can buy Vivien of Holloway's fashion items from their own website, from the Australian boutique called "Christine's" - which you can find on facebook and now and again from ebay.

Collectif

This blog post is my review on the vintage reproduction clothing brand Collectif!












Collectif are based in the UK and mainly sell women's vintage style clothing for example dresses, skirts, blouses, trousers, shorts and knitwear etc and ladies accessories for example jewellery, handbags, hats, sunglasses and belts etc.
Collectif have their own website where you can purchase yourself something really well-made and lovely from, their website is: https://www.collectif.co.uk/.

I currently own 2 gorgeous dresses, a top and a cardigan from this brand! The first dress I bought myself was around three months ago from Collectif's official website, at the time they were currently having a "sale" on a lot of their items and I got myself the pink hibiscus sarong dress for a very reasonable price!
Pink Hibiscus Sarong dress




I really love the print and design of this dress, it's so "pinup tiki inspired" and very tropical looking. A great dress to wear for spring/summer!

This dress is really well-made and constructed. It's also lined and comes with a matching belt. This dress has a back zipper to get in and out off.

It's such a beautiful dress to wear and fits well!











Here I am personally styling the "pink hibiscus sarong dress".
So far I have found Collectif clothing to be very well-made and designed, as both dresses I do own are lined, and the fabric is of very good quality.
Collectif pricing is around the medium price range, usually between $60 - $120 for a particular item of clothing. But from time to time you can pick up something really beautiful on "sale" for yourself  like I have. You just need to be willing to look around online for a "bargain"!

The next dress I bought myself was around two months ago, from an ebay seller. Once again for a reasonable price, this dress is called the violet cherry print dress.



I just had to had to buy this dress, because of the cherry fabric print and it was selling for such a good price.

I also love the design and style of this dress, it's very 1940's vintage inspired!

This dress is also lined, has a side zipper to get in and out of and has 4 little pearl buttons on the front.
Also it fits on me really well.









Myself styling the "violet cherry print dress".
You can buy Collectif clothing from their own website, ebay, and from most rockabilly/pinup/vintage inspired websites and stores.

Popular Vintage/Retro Inspired Photoshoot Props!

I love looking at vintage, rockabilly, pinup outfit inspired photo-shoots, and looking at the stunning ladies wearing their gorgeous outfits, but I've also notice the props used in some of these photo-shoots!
This blog post is a list of the vintage inspired photo-shoot props I think are the most popular and true vintage inspired.

Starting off with:
Hot-rods
Personally I think this is the most popular prop used for vintage inspired photo-shoots. These style of photo-shoots are aimed visually for both male and female audiences. As there are:
"Hot-rod" vehicles, the gorgeous ladies, plus the ladies vintage inspired outfits.

Parasol/umbrellas
Using a parasol or umbrella in a vintage inspired photo-shoot is another popular prop used, especially used by ladies, at rockabilly and vintage festival's or if their is a photo-shoot to be done outside at the beach, park etc. As well as being used as a prop, they're also can be an essential part of the ladies vintage inspired outfit.

Vintage telephones
Using a vintage telephone in a photo-shoot does show the type of vintage telephone used and what the gorgeous ladies are wearing but also gives the impression that the girls in the photos are potentially speaking to their friend, boyfriend or their lover!

Suitcase/luggage
Using suitcases/luggage as props is very retro inspired, as they give the impression the ladies in the photos are either going on a holiday, leaving their home town to "follow their dreams" or leaving their ex-boyfriend or family.

Drinks
Using drinks as props in photo-shoots such as milkshakes and bottles of coca cola, is very 1940's/50's. This also gives the impression the girls/gents are at a 1950's American style diner.

1950's Kitchen
Using a 1940's/50's style kitchen for photo-shoots, gives the impression of a 1950's "housewife", cleaning, cooking and baking for their husband and children, whilst wearing and showing of their vintage/retro outfits/aprons.

Records
Using records in photo-shoots is very retro inspired (1950's/60's), as that's what was mainly used back then to listen and dance to their favorite music acts/stars.

Makeup
Applying makeup products in vintage/retro inspired photo-shoots, is also another popular prop used to give the impression of the ladies getting ready to go-out in their vintage inspired outfits.

Voodoo Vixen

This blog post is about my review on the vintage reproduction brand called Voodoo Vixen.










Voodoo Vixen are based in the UK and mainly sell rockabilly/pinup/vintage inspired dresses, skirts, tops/blouses, shorts, play-suits, cardigans and some handbags.  Voodoo Vixen have their own website, where you can purchase yourself a gorgeous clothing piece for yourself, the website is: http://www.voodoovixen.co.uk/

I currently own two dresses from this brand, the first I bought for myself around six months ago from an Australian clothing boutique, on facebook for a reasonable price. The dress is called "kitty cut out swing dress".
Kitty dress



I just love the print design with the little black cats on this dress, and the pink background. I also love the style of this dress with the cut out neckline and the little pockets.
Another bonus is that this dress came with a cute black belt.

The dress has a side zipper to get in and out off.
This dress fits me perfectly and I like the length as well.

It's just so pretty and cute!




Here I am personally styling this cute dress. I've just added my own belts to it, instead of the black one. Just to change the look a bit.


Voodoo Vixen have some really awesome novelty prints, great colors and designs on their fashion items! This brands clothing is also of a very good quality for their prices, which ranges from low to medium prices. Usually between $40 - $90, depending on the style, design and look of the fashion item.

The next dress I bought for myself was around three weeks ago for a very reasonable price which was from an Australian boutique called Gwynnies Emporium the website address is: http://gwynnies.com.au/
This dress I bought is called "Angie dress".
Angie dress



I really love the floral design print and the wrinkled front bust area of this dress. Also the light blue background, just so pretty!

It's such a lovely dress to wear in the spring/summer seasons. Especially because of the length, as it is a little shorter then my other rockabilly/pinup/50's inspired dresses.

Once again this dress is a good fit. Only thing I've found the straps do fall down from time to time, but that's probably because of my smaller bust size!




Here is myself personally styling this lovely dress.

You can purchase Voodoo Vixen vintage inspired clothing for the modern woman from their actual website, from ebay, and from most rockabilly/pinup/vintage inspired clothing boutiques and websites.
